The OEM Team Account Coordinator is responsible for managing all aspects of their assigned accounts, recognizing when to escalate customer issues, and supporting customers with price and availability, simple product information and referral to appropriate specialist for technical support and/or problem resolution when warranted.

Account Coordinators on the OEM Team work primarily through email correspondence with specifically assigned accounts and are responsible for all interactions with their assigned customers, including discrepancy resolution, RGA's and credits, shipping and tracking follow-up, escalations, and CAID resolution. A basic knowledge of order entry processes is a plus.

You will make an impact with the following responsibilities:

  • Respond and resolve problems in a timely and accurate manner while providing excellent customer service.
  • Utilize email and SieSales to directly communicate to customers, suppliers and affiliates.
  • Manage shipping discrepancies issues, from inception to completion.
  • Manage and resolve CAIDs associated with the assigned accounts in a timely manner.
  • Process non-complex change orders.
  • Follow up and engage stakeholders as required until the expected release date for open orders are addressed accordingly.
